BHC’s Board of Directors Elects Two New Members

The Blackstone River Valley National Heritage Corridor Board of Directors elected two new Board members at its March meeting, including Sue Ciaramicoli of Hopedale, MA, and Paul Jones of North Smithfield, RI. Sue is the Volunteer Curator at the Little Red Shop Museum in Hopedale and Co-Chair and Recording Secretary of Hopedale’s Historical Commission. Paul is the president of The Care Concierge of New England. Both were elected for a three-year term.
